The method described is an almost universal bit-efficient video compressing approach that can be used in various coding applications. The main goal is to reconstruct images in high quality by using a universal image coder with easy bit-level access. The idea is to search for unsteady regions in the image and to approximate the stationary regions separately and combining both of them.
